Things To Do
in Nārnaul

Nārnaul is a historical town located in the Mahendragarh district of Haryana, India. Known for its rich heritage and ancient architecture, it serves as a gateway to the Aravalli hills. The town is famous for its vibrant culture, traditional crafts, and warm hospitality.

Visitors can explore various temples, forts, and local markets that reflect the town's rich history.

Culinary Guide

Food in Nārnaul

Nārnaul offers a delightful culinary experience, showcasing a blend of traditional Haryanvi dishes and regional delicacies.

Nārnaul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Bajra Khichdi

A comforting dish made with pearl millet and lentils, often served with ghee and pickles.

Must-Try!

Gajar Ka Halwa

A sweet dessert made from grated carrots, milk, and sugar, often garnished with nuts.

Climate Guide

Weather

Nārnaul experiences a semi-arid climate. Summers (March to June) are hot, with temperatures soaring above 40°C (104°F), while winters (November to February) are mild and pleasant, averaging 10-20°C (50-68°F). The monsoon season brings moderate rainfall from July to September, providing a much-needed respite from the summer heat.

Tipping in Nārnaul

Ensure a smooth experience

Tipping Customs

It is customary to tip service staff around 10% of the bill in restaurants; for taxi drivers, rounding up is appreciated.

Payment Methods

Cash is widely accepted, but digital payments through apps like Paytm are becoming increasingly popular.
